How to fill out the Section 7 Private Laboratory Guidance - Food And Drug Administration - FDA online

Filling out the Section 7 Private Laboratory Guidance form is a critical step for importers seeking compliance with FDA regulations regarding private laboratory analyses.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to assist users in completing the form accurately and effectively.

Follow the steps to complete the Section 7 form.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in your editor.
  2. Begin by filling in Section 7.1, which includes the objective of the analysis. Here, you will need to state the purpose of using a private laboratory for your specific imported commodity evaluation.
  3. In Section 7.1.1, provide a concise introduction regarding the compliance requirements of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act for the imported articles.
  4. For Section 7.2, document the sampling process. Ensure that the sampling method represents the entire lot being imported, adhering to the FDA-recommended procedures.
  5. In Section 7.3, you will input detailed information about the private laboratory you are using. This includes the laboratory’s name, address, contact information, and an overview of its capabilities.
  6. Complete Section 7.3.1 by detailing the backgrounds and qualifications of the private laboratory analysts. Attach relevant CVs for each analyst involved in the analysis.
  7. Proceed to fill out Section 7.3.2, the review of the analytical packages. Make sure that all components of the documentation, including reports and collection methods, are complete and accurate.
  8. Continue to Sections 7.4 through 7.9 by providing required information on audit samples, on-site assessments, consultations, meetings, and any continuing problems that may arise during the analysis process.
  9. For the final step, review all information carefully before saving your form. You can then download, print, or share the completed document as necessary.

The FDA regulates areas including the safety of food products, pharmaceuticals, medical devices, cosmetics, biologics, dietary supplements, tobacco products, and veterinary products. Each of these areas has specific compliance requirements and safety standards. Laboratories involved in any of these sectors must understand the implications of the regulations.
